Transaction 362d91c21a83c459574f2f1f38d24701f9c5ed8e2d1371aed7faed86f44fcce9

153 Input
2 Outputs
  • 362d91c21a83c459574f2f1f38d24701f9c5ed8e2d1371aed7faed86f44fcce9:0
  • value  513845625
    address  33ze68qZoBE9R4uMtRQGNnvgFTYN4sPBUq
  • 362d91c21a83c459574f2f1f38d24701f9c5ed8e2d1371aed7faed86f44fcce9:1
  • value  1391222
    address  33iFqvvSPMBY6F7GVwoZRcJLewx2U3P73K